Output 3a1a26367605fac2b6018680995357bec021e775ad7a69a6859b9be345215b41:0

value
34842245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bf24419a93402de6c5b641376f89009f32e124e OP_EQUAL
address
MLf8P2qk8Fswy7pCLnUGNrtRksCFWAYBzB
transaction
3a1a26367605fac2b6018680995357bec021e775ad7a69a6859b9be345215b41
spent
true